Branston Brings Italian Potatoes to Tesco

Branston, UK’s largest potato supplier, is fulfilling Tesco’s requirement for fresh seasonal new potatoes, which are due to be in supermarkets from the end of October, for six weeks.

New season potatoes have enjoyed strong growth over the last 52 weeks with 86% value growth vs. a year ago. To meet consumer demand, Tesco has also made seasonal new potatoes available in more stores, compared to last year.

George Christoudias, sales and marketing director at Branston said: “Our research has shown that shoppers want freshly harvested new potatoes and that the availability to purchase new potatoes is more important than them being from British farms. The Italian climate in the late summer is perfect for planting new potatoes, while here in the UK we’re busy harvesting and eating ours. Timing is perfect as by late October when UK varieties have finished, Italian new potatoes are ready to eat.”

Italian seasonal new potatoes are grown along a 10-mile strip of coastline in free-draining sandy soil and are harvested by hand to protect their skins. Italian new potatoes will be available loose and in a specially designed perforated 750g bag to keep them fresher for longer across 790 Tesco stores.
